**Action Item 7: Rebuild the static-analysis baseline.** The Harrowlint baseline file for the Pinefold repo grew stale and suppressed the null-deref class that caused this outage. Going forward, the baseline regenerates on a schedule rather than ad hoc, and any entry older than the expiry window fails CI. Maintainers should not hand-edit the file; use the regen task. The expiry and size limits are controlled by the constants below.

tuning constants:
RATE_LIMITS = {
    "wenwyn": 1,
    "zorix": 10,
    "oliix": 2,
    "holael": 10,
}

**Migration Notes: Cron → Weavework (for weekly eng sync)**

We are moving the remaining cron jobs on the Perchline boxes into the Weavework workflow engine. Each migrated job becomes a declarative workflow with retries, timeouts, and lineage tracking, registered through the Weavework admin API. Please migrate only jobs you own and verify the first scheduled run. Registration calls authenticate with the key below.

API key for yahig-tadup: kto7_ubizbYm

### Changelog — GiveNote Receipt Mailer (w/o sprint 14)

Heads up for the sync: we changed the mailer defaults after the Harvest Fund pilot flooded retries last week. Receipts now batch hourly instead of per-donation, the retry backoff doubled, and plaintext fallback is on by default so Tove's accessibility audit passes. Nothing else moved, but anyone running a local GiveNote instance should refresh their overrides. The new default configuration values are listed below.

config for kawif-hahig:
zorix:
  log_level: error
  metrics_host: metrics.zorix.lumiclabs.internal
  pool_size: 16

**Item 14 — Audit-Log Viewer Access Review.** Verify that the Tracegate viewer restricts export functions to support leads, that session queries are themselves logged, and that retention filters cannot be bypassed via saved searches. Record any discrepancies in the quarterly register. The accountable owner for this control is named below.

account owner for bawip-tahag: Raleth Quenok